Dr. Loretta N. McGregor to serve as guest speaker for 2025 Hope High School commencement.
Dr. McGregor is no stranger to this community. She is a proud Hope High School graduate—a hometown success story whose journey is a testament to hard work, perseverance, and excellence. While at Hope High, she was an active student leader, involved in the band, student council, and numerous other activities. Today, she stands before us as an accomplished scholar, educator, and trailblazer.
Currently serving as the Associate Dean for the College of Education and Behavioral Science at Arkansas State University, Dr. McGregor has dedicated over 30 years to higher education. She has held numerous leadership roles, including chairperson of the Department of Psychology and Counseling and president of the Faculty Senate. She is also the Immediate Past President of the Society for the Teaching of Psychology, a division of the American Psychological Association—a role in which she made history as the first Black president in its 75-year history.
Dr. McGregor’s contributions to psychology, education, and research are profound. She has been recognized for her work on the Imposter Phenomenon and has conducted extensive research on Dr. Mamie Phipps Clark, whose studies were instrumental in the historic Brown v. Board of Education decision. Her passion for teaching and advocacy for psychology educators have left a lasting impact on the field.

Hope Collegiate Academy (HCA) and HHS/UAHT concurrent students Riley Bramlett and Katie Ella Webster served as pages for Rep. Dolly Henley in the Arkansas House of Representatives at the Capitol. While there, they met Former Arkansas Governor and First Lady, Mike and Janet Huckabee! Hope High School students taking part in OBU Talent Search attended Career & College Day at OBU and HSU. There were over 25 employers in the building for the students to visit with. Students enjoyed visiting the Workforce Mobile Truck. The students took part in an activity allowing them to choose a career they would like to pursue which provided them with an income and expenses. Some students said," I must choose another career so I can afford to life". The tour at HSU was great with lots of walking and information. Each student came back with lots of valuable information on how to enter the workforce, how to enter college, and a t-shirt from HSU. Lunch was provided by OBU on their campus. It was a great opportunity and eye opener for the students!
